What is a High Output Alternator?

A high-output alternator generates more electrical power than a standard alternator. While your stock alternator might produce around 130-160 amps, a high-output unit can easily reach 180 amps or even higher, depending on the model. This increased amperage allows your truck to power all its accessories without strain, even under heavy load.

Why Upgrade Your 2012 Ram 1500's Alternator?

Several reasons might prompt you to consider a high-output alternator upgrade for your 2012 Ram 1500 5.7L Hemi:

  • Powering Aftermarket Accessories: Adding a powerful sound system, off-road lights, a winch, or other accessories often exceeds the capacity of the stock alternator.
  • Preventing Battery Drain: Consistent undercharging from insufficient alternator output can lead to premature battery failure. A high-output alternator ensures your battery stays fully charged, even with heavy accessory use.
  • Improved Electrical System Performance: A more robust alternator provides a stable power supply, preventing voltage drops that can cause flickering lights or malfunctioning electronics.
  • Enhanced Reliability: Reliable power delivery is crucial, especially when off-roading or relying on accessories in emergency situations.

Choosing the Right High Output Alternator

Selecting the correct high-output alternator for your 2012 Ram 1500 5.7L Hemi requires careful consideration:

  • Amperage Rating: Choose an alternator with a sufficiently high amperage rating to handle all your accessories' current draw. Overestimating is better than underestimating.
  • Mounting and Pulley: Ensure the alternator's mounting style and pulley size are compatible with your vehicle. Some high-output alternators may require brackets or adjustments.
  • Brand Reputation: Opt for reputable brands known for quality and reliability. Research reviews and compare different models before purchasing.
  • Warranty: Check the warranty offered by the manufacturer to protect your investment.

How to Install a High Output Alternator (General Overview)

Note: This section provides a general overview. Always consult a professional mechanic or your vehicle's repair manual for detailed instructions specific to your model. Improper installation can damage your electrical system.

The installation process typically involves:

  1. Disconnecting the Battery: Disconnect the negative terminal of your battery to prevent electrical shocks.
  2. Removing the Old Alternator: Remove the alternator belts, mounting bolts, and wiring connections.
  3. Installing the New Alternator: Mount the new high-output alternator and secure it with the appropriate bolts.
  4. Reconnecting the Wiring and Belts: Reconnect the wiring harnesses and install the new belts, ensuring proper tension.
  5. Reconnecting the Battery: Reconnect the negative battery terminal.
  6. Testing: Test the alternator's output to confirm it's functioning correctly.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the signs of a failing alternator?

Signs of a failing alternator include dimming headlights, sluggish engine performance, warning lights on your dashboard (like the battery light), and difficulty starting the engine.

Can I install a high-output alternator myself?

While possible, installing a high-output alternator is a moderately complex task requiring some mechanical knowledge. If you are not comfortable working on your vehicle's electrical system, it's best to seek professional help.

Will a high-output alternator damage my vehicle?

A properly chosen and installed high-output alternator should not damage your vehicle. However, improper installation can lead to electrical problems, so it's crucial to follow instructions carefully or consult a professional.

How much does a high-output alternator cost?

The cost varies depending on the brand, amperage rating, and features. Expect to pay anywhere from a few hundred to several hundred dollars.

How long does a high-output alternator last?

The lifespan of a high-output alternator is comparable to that of a standard alternator—typically several years with proper maintenance.
